CPU, 코어, 다이 및 패키지라는 용어는 무엇을 의미합니까?

CPU, 코어, 다이 및 패키지라는 용어는 무엇을 의미합니까?

이전 질문이 너무 많은 것처럼 들릴 수도 있지만, 이 용어에 대해 정말 혼란스럽습니다. "듀얼 코어"가 "코어 2 듀오"와 어떻게 다른지 이해하려고 노력한 결과 몇 가지 답을 얻었습니다. 예를 들어, 이답변상태:

Core 2 Duo에는 단일 물리적 패키지 내에 2개의 코어가 있습니다.

그리고

듀얼 코어는 패키지에 CPU 2개 다이에 CPU 2개 = CPU 2개가 함께 만들어짐 패키지에 CPU 2개 = 작은 보드에 CPU 2개 또는 어떤 방식으로 연결됨

그렇다면 코어는 CPU와 다른 걸까요? 내가 이해하는 것은 모든 무거운 계산, 의사 결정, 수학 및 기타 작업(일명 "처리")을 수행하는 CPU라고 하는 것이 있다는 것입니다. 이제 코어란 무엇입니까? 그리고 누군가가 자신이 Core 2 Duo를 갖고 있다고 말할 때 프로세서란 무엇입니까? 그리고 이러한 맥락에서 패키지는 무엇이고 다이는 무엇입니까?

저는 아직도 Core 2 Duo와 Dual Core의 차이점을 이해하지 못합니다. 그리고 누군가 설명해줄 수 있나요하이퍼스레딩(대칭 멀티스레딩)그들이 매우 관대하다면?

답변1

"Core 2 Duo"는 일부 프로세서에 대한 Intel의 상표 이름입니다. Core 2 Intel 아키텍처를 사용하는 것을 제외하고는 프로세서에 대해 많은 정보를 제공하지 않습니다.

(물리적) 프로세서 코어다른 코어와 병렬로 한 번에 하나의 프로그램 스레드를 실행할 수 있는 독립적인 실행 단위입니다.

프로세서 다이반도체 재료(보통 실리콘)의 단일 연속 조각입니다. 다이에는 원하는 수의 코어가 포함될 수 있습니다. 인텔 제품 라인에서는 최대 15개까지 사용할 수 있습니다. 프로세서 다이는 CPU를 구성하는 트랜지스터가 실제로 위치하는 곳입니다.

프로세서 패키지단일 프로세서를 구입하면 얻을 수 있는 것입니다. 여기에는 하나 이상의 다이, 다이용 플라스틱/세라믹 하우징, 마더보드의 것과 일치하는 금도금 접점이 포함되어 있습니다.

항상 최소한 하나의 코어, 하나의 다이 및 하나의 패키지가 있다는 점에 유의하십시오. 프로세서가 이해되려면 명령을 실행할 수 있는 장치, 프로세서를 구현하는 트랜지스터를 물리적으로 포함하는 실리콘 조각, 마더보드 및 IO에 결합되는 접점에 해당 실리콘을 연결하는 패키지가 있어야 합니다.

듀얼 코어 프로세서프로세서입니다패키지내부에는 두 개의 물리적 코어가 있습니다. 하나의 주사위 또는 두 개의 주사위에 있을 수 있습니다. 종종 1세대 멀티 코어 프로세서는 단일 패키지에 여러 개의 다이를 사용했지만 현대 설계에서는 다이 내 캐시를 공유할 수 있는 것과 같은 이점을 제공하는 동일한 다이에 배치했습니다.

용어"CPU"모호할 수 있습니다. 사람들이 "CPU"를 구매하면 CPU 패키지를 구매하게 됩니다. "CPU 확장"을 검사할 때 논리 코어에 대해 이야기합니다. 그 이유는 대부분의 실용적인 목적을 위해 듀얼 코어 프로세서가 두 개의 프로세서 시스템처럼 동작하기 때문입니다. 2개의 CPU 소켓과 2개의 CPU 단일 코어 패키지가 설치된 시스템이므로 확장에 관해 이야기할 때 사용 가능한 코어 수를 계산하는 것이 가장 합리적입니다. 다이, 패키지 및 마더보드에 설치하는 방법은 덜 중요합니다.

용어"패키지"또한 여러 가지 의미가 있습니다. 여기서 CPU "패키지"는 CPU를 포함하는 플라스틱, 세라믹 및 금속 조각을 의미합니다. 마더보드의 각 CPU 소켓은 정확히 하나의 패키지를 수용할 수 있습니다. 패키지는 소켓에 연결되는 장치입니다.

2다이 쿼드 코어 프로세서의 예를 볼 수 있습니다.여기.

CPU 또는 CPU 패키지는 첫 번째 사진의 위쪽과 아래쪽에서 찍은 사진입니다. 여기에 이미지 설명을 입력하세요

상단의 금속색 직사각형은 2개의 CPU 다이입니다. 각각에는 2개의 CPU 코어가 포함되어 총 4개가 됩니다. 하단의 금색 핀은 마더보드의 커넥터에 연결됩니다.

~에이 페이지너는 볼 수있어하나두 번째 이미지의 Core 2 Quad에 있는 두 다이 중 하나입니다.

여기에 이미지 설명을 입력하세요

보시다시피 대칭입니다. 위쪽에는 하나의 코어가 있고 아래쪽에는 두 번째 코어가 있습니다. 이와 같은 실리콘 2개를 CPU 패키지에 붙여 쿼드코어 코어2쿼드를 만든다.

답변2

CPU 패키지

여기에 이미지 설명을 입력하세요

CPU를 구입하면 보통 이런 모습을 보게 됩니다.

  • 마더보드 소켓과 접촉하기 위해 바닥에 핀이나 접점이 포함된 보드 조각입니다.
  • CPU 다이를 물리적 손상으로부터 보호하고 방열판을 지지하며 열적으로 결합되는 금속, 때로는 세라믹으로 만들어진 상단 쉘은 EMI 차폐 역할을 할 수 있습니다.
  • 바이패스 캡은 소음을 억제하고 CPU로 가는 전압을 평활화하는 데 사용되는 작은 커패시터입니다.
  • 상단 셸 내부의 실제 CPU입니다.

CPU 다이

CPU 다이는 처리 장치 자체입니다. 다양한 제조 공정을 통해 논리 블록 네트워크로 조각/에칭/증착되어 컴퓨팅을 가능하게 하는 반도체 조각입니다.

여기에 이미지 설명을 입력하세요
실제 다이를 노출하는 열린 CPU 패키지

여기에 이미지 설명을 입력하세요
레이아웃 구성을 설명하는 오버레이가 있는 다이의 현미경 보기
* 펜티엄 4는 단일 코어가 있는 단일 CPU입니다.


CPU 코어

최신 CPU에는 거의 독립적인 처리 장치인 여러 개의 코어가 있습니다. 공급업체는 동일한 패키지에 독립적인 다이로 코어를 제조하거나 동일한 다이에 에칭할 수 있습니다.

여기에 이미지 설명을 입력하세요
2개의 개별 DIE가 포함된 CPU 패키지

여기에 이미지 설명을 입력하세요
여러 코어가 있는 하나의 다이

코어를 완전한 독립 처리 장치로 이해하십시오. 사실, 당신은 그것들이 거의 사본이라는 것을 알 수 있습니다.


브랜드 이름

Intel Core 2 Duo™Intel Dual Core™Intel의 상표 이름입니다 .

인텔이 이러한 CPU 라인에 이름을 붙인 방식일 뿐이며, 그 안에 2개의 코어가 있다는 단서를 제공한다는 사실 외에는 어떤 식으로든 별로 의미가 없습니다.

현재 Intel 세대 이름은 Intel Core i3, Intel Core i5및 입니다 Intel Core i7. 이 이름들은 당신에게 아무 것도 말해주지 않습니다. 예를 들어 Intel Core i5코어가 2개만 있는 경우도 있고 코어가 4개 있는 경우도 있습니다. 일반적으로 이를 광고하지 않기 때문에 이를 알기 위해서는 데이터시트를 읽어야 합니다.


소프트웨어

소프트웨어 관점에서 볼 때 CPU나 코어는 거의 동일합니다. 그것들이 각각 자체 다이에 있는지, 아니면 동일한 다이에 에칭되어 있는지는 알 수 없습니다. 이는 독립적인 처리 장치로 처리되므로 각각에 대해 서로 다른 작업을 실행할 수 있습니다.

답변3

마케팅에서는 제품을 지칭하기 위해 기술 용어를 사용하기 시작했고 구어체와 일반적인 사용이 항상 원래의 기술 용어와 일치하지 않기 때문에 이 영역에서 용어는 혼란스럽습니다.

집적 회로는 일반적으로 자동차 한 대처럼 별도의 조각으로 제조되지 않지만, 그 중 여러 개는 레이어 케이크처럼 실리콘 웨이퍼 위에 "구축"됩니다. 작업이 완료되면 개별 회로가 웨이퍼에서 절단되고, 얻은 작은 조각을 "다이"라고 합니다.

CPU에는 단순화하기 위해 "계산할 수 있는" 하나 이상의 실행 단위가 있으며 이를 "코어"라고 합니다. CPU 코어는 별도의 다이로 생산될 수 있지만 동일한 다이에 배치될 수도 있습니다. 그렇다면 해당 코어가 "다이를 공유"한다고 말할 수 있습니다.

다이가 유용한 작업을 수행하려면 외부 세계에 연결되어야 하므로 일부 캐리어에 "접착"되고 연결이 납땜되어 "패키지"라고 합니다.

편집: "단일 물리적 패키지"는 이제 다른 의미를 가질 수 있습니다(약간 족제비 같은 단어입니다). 하나의 다이에 있는 두 개의 코어는 동일한 패키지를 공유합니다. 하지만 두 개의 다이에 있는 두 개의 코어가 동일한 패키지를 공유할 수도 있습니다...

AMD와 Intel 마케팅 간의 논쟁 중 하나는 "네이티브 듀얼 코어"가 별도의 코어 다이보다 나은지에 대한 것입니다. 이 두 가지 접근 방식의 제조 공정을 살펴보는 것은 매우 흥미롭지만, 최종 사용자에게는 특정 CPU가 어떻게 구축되었는지는 중요하지 않습니다. 즉 성능과 발열이 중요합니다.

CPU는 캐시와 같은 코어보다 더 많은 기능을 필요로 하므로 코어는 CPU의 한 요소입니다.

"Core 2 Duo"는 Intel 마케팅이 생각해낸 이름일 뿐입니다. 그것이 더 잘 팔릴 것이라고 약속했다면 그들은 그것을 "샐리"라고 불렀을 것입니다.

"듀얼 코어"는 두 개의 코어가 있는 모든 것을 가리키는 일반적인 용어입니다.

주의: 그것은 제가 그린 매우 넓은 브러시이며, 현대 기술을 보면 지나치게 단순화되었습니다.

답변4

네, "die"는 "주사위"의 단수형이고 (둥근 방식으로) 당근을 깍둑썰기하는 것에서 유래했습니다. 일부 장치(예: CPU, 메모리 컨트롤러, 디스플레이 어댑터)의 여러 복사본을 포함하는 대형 원형 실리콘 웨이퍼가 생산된 다음 개별 직사각형 다이로 "조각"됩니다. 이 용어는 집적회로가 탄생한 이후 약 45년 동안 사용되었습니다.

"핵심"은 20년이 채 안 된 다소 새로운 용어입니다. 다중 프로세서 패키지에서 단일 처리 장치(단일 실행 스레드)를 나타내는 데 사용됩니다.

"CPU"는 아마도 가장 오래되고 가장 모호한 용어일 것입니다. 이는 컴퓨터 시스템을 포함하는 전체 상자, 하나 이상의 프로세서를 포함하는 집적 회로 패키지 또는 개별 프로세서를 지칭하는 데 사용될 수 있습니다.

"CPU"에는 여러 가지 의미가 있지만 집적 회로가 포함된 작은 플라스틱 또는 세라믹 패키지에는 여러 가지 용어가 있습니다. 이는 ("성장한" 위치에 따라) "패키지", "모듈", "칩"(다이를 지칭하는 데에도 사용할 수 있는 용어), "IC"(집적 회로)라고 부를 수 있습니다. ), "DIP"(많은 경우 더 이상 이중 인라인 플라스틱 패키지가 아님) 및 기타 여러 가지가 있습니다.

관련 정보